The G7 Culture Summit is scheduled to open in Naples on Friday, September 20.

Bocelli will perform with conductor Carlo Bernini, while internationally renowned soprano Carmen Giannattasio will star in a concert directed by conductor Beatrice Venezi, who leads the Nuova Orchestra Scarlatti.

To mark the 100th anniversary of Giacomo Puccini’s death, Giannattasio - known for her interpretation of Tosca in the opera of the same name - will perform Vissi D’Arte.

She will also perform Casta Diva from Norma and La Danza by Gioacchino Rossini as an homage to the city hosting the G7 Culture Summit.

The G7 event will kick off on Friday at Palazzo Reale in the port city.

Delegations, however, are scheduled to arrive in Naples on Thursday afternoon when they will visit the National Archaeological Museum.

They are also set to attend a performance starring young artists from the Conservatorio San Pietro a Majella.
